Transaction 16af4231561f63d3d590e4713f11332b58b81f0eb592c2f2220a9693a0c35cf5
1 Input
1 Output
-
16af4231561f63d3d590e4713f11332b58b81f0eb592c2f2220a9693a0c35cf5:0
- value
- 412062
- script pubkey
- OP_0 OP_PUSHBYTES_20 5d36000c2a1b790d30544bca718ecf59a12a6531
- address
- bc1qt5mqqrp2rdus6vz5f098rrk0txsj5ef3lhm49x